Abstract Engineering education is passing through a paradigm shift in teaching millennials. Sage on stage is replaced with facilitator by the side to have an effective teaching learning process. This paper concentrates on the physical, emotional and intellectual quotient (PQ+EQ+IQ) of the students to impart a holistic learning. Nurturing Engineering Skills and Talents (NEST) brings in the concept for which a survey with considerable candidates from various geographic location, gender and family backgrounds are considered. Nurturing Existing Skills and Talents, learners are to be provided with a nurturing, caring and protected environment where their emotional needs are met. Instead of one cap fits all method a highly flexible course system where Inter and Trans Disciplinary (ITD) approach is to be adopted. Skill sets of the learners are to be identified scientifically and to be groomed. NEST also brings in Nurturing Engineering/Enhancing Skills and Talents in the learners. Experiential learning is to be introduced into every course so that any technology that is considered as distraction could be changed to a disruptive one to improve teaching learning process.
